Onboarding note for the Ledgerpane admin table: bulk edits are applied through the batcher service, not directly against the database. Select rows, choose an action, and the batcher stages changes in a pending set you can review before commit. Edits over 500 rows require a second approver — this is enforced server-side, so don't try to chunk around it. To run the batcher locally you need the staging write credential, which goes in your .env as the next line.

secret setting of bahip-kagag: RELAY_SECRET3=c83

## Contacts: Image Slimming (Project Thimbleweight)

Thimbleweight owns base-image trimming and layer dedup for all Corvid Build pipelines. Questions about excluded packages, multi-stage templates, or size budgets go to them — not the registry team. Don't hand-edit the slimming manifests; changes without their sign-off get reverted by the nightly audit. Send slimming requests and exemption appeals to the owners at the address below.

alerts address for kajog-tadup: druox@plorvanet.internal

- [ ] **Step 7: Breaker override escrow.** After sealing the signing keys for the Tallgrove upstream API circuit breaker, confirm the support team can force the breaker open during a full outage. The override bundle lives in the sealed escrow drawer and is useless without its unlock phrase. Two ceremony witnesses must initial this step before proceeding. The escrow bundle is decrypted with the recovery passphrase that follows.

vault phrase of kahip-kahop = holath-quenmir